Subject: [dpdk-dev] [PATCH 2/3] doc: update eventdev feature matrix for octeontx2
Date: Thu, 7 Nov 2019 16:44:53 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20191107111454.17295-2-skori@marvell.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20191107111454.17295-1-skori@marvell.com>
Patch updates eventdev and adapters feature metrices for octeontx2
platform.
Signed-off-by: Sunil Kumar Kori <skori@marvell.com>
---
doc/guides/eventdevs/features/octeontx2.ini | 16 ++++++++++++++++
.../eventdevs/overview_adptr_feature_table.txt | 4 ++--
doc/guides/eventdevs/overview_feature_table.txt | 12 ++++++------
3 files changed, 24 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
create mode 100644 doc/guides/eventdevs/features/octeontx2.ini
diff --git a/doc/guides/eventdevs/features/octeontx2.ini b/doc/guides/eventdevs/features/octeontx2.ini
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..05718e4ac
--- /dev/null
+++ b/doc/guides/eventdevs/features/octeontx2.ini
@@ -0,0 +1,16 @@
+;
+; Supported features of the 'octeontx2' eventdev driver.
+;
+; Refer to default.ini for the full list of available PMD features.
+;
+[Features]
+Event queue priority based scheduling = Y
+Event device distributed scheduling = Y
+Event device non sequential mode = Y
+Event queue all types = Y
+Runtime event queue/port linking = Y
+Multi queue linking per port = Y
+
+[Adapter Features]
+Rx/Tx on internal port = Y
+Multiple event queues per ethdev = Y
